Michel is back now from vacation and from working at CERN on the testbeam. He reported that using Athena for the on-line monitoring is going really well. Rob regularly introduces new updates, and unlike in previous years, lots of other people are contributing to the software as well. One of the strong points of the monitoring package is that large parts of it can be used for both beamlines H6 and H8.

Margret and Ian are making good progress on cleaning up the LArG4TBEmecHec code. Ian has almost finished a complete re-write of the part of the code that reads the G4 HitsCollections and fills them into the Root Tree. Margret has made the HEC and the EMEC sensitive to CalibrationHits. She also wrote a few draft slides for a presentation during the simulation meeting at the Lar week.
